Three more killed, six hurt in South.

Three people, including one soldier, were killed and six others injured in a wave of bombings and shootings in the Muslim-majority South, police said yesterday.

Five soldiers were injured when a 15-kilogram roadside bomb overturned their Humvee early yesterday in Narathiwat's Sungai Padi district. The troops were conducting a routine patrol when they came under the bomb attack, which investigators believe was set off remotely by mobile phone.
